Here are my two cents - some info from the period documentation (original documents from my grandfather's archive - grandfather was a NCO in 31st Infantry Regiment, 10th Infantry Division, 1936-1939):
1. Książka rozjazdów baonu manewrowego 10 D.P. (Traffic / movement book of maneuvering battalion of 10 Inf.Div.)
and clear indication of name and surname of "woźnica".
2. Spis strzelców taborowych batalionu manewrowego w O.C. Barycz (Register of cart drivers of maneuvering battalion in training camp Barycz)
and quite different term - "taboryta" (but it could be used as general description of soldiers attached to horse drawn carriage)
Term "woźnica" is most suitable then.
